[PATCH v2] arm64: dts: qcom: sdm630: fix gpu_speed_bin size
Posted by Dmitry Baryshkov 5 days, 7 hours ago
Historically sdm630.dtsi has used 1 byte length for the gpu_speed_bin
cell, although it spans two bytes (offset 5, size 7 bits). It was being
accepted by the kernel because before the commit 7a06ef751077 ("nvmem:
core: fix bit offsets of more than one byte") the kernel didn't have
length check. After this commit nvmem core rejects QFPROM on sdm630 /
sdm660, making GPU and USB unusable on those platforms.

Set the size of the gpu_speed_bin cell to 2 bytes, fixing the parsing
error. While we are at it, update the length to 8 bits as pointed out by
Alexey Minnekhanov.

Fixes: b190fb010664 ("arm64: dts: qcom: sdm630: Add sdm630 dts file")

diff --git a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sdm630.dtsi b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sdm630.dtsi
index 8b1a45a4e56e..b383e480a394 100644
--- a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sdm630.dtsi
+++ b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sdm630.dtsi
@@ -598,8 +598,8 @@ qusb2_hstx_trim: hstx-trim@240 {
 			};
 
 			gpu_speed_bin: gpu-speed-bin@41a0 {
-				reg = <0x41a2 0x1>;
-				bits = <5 7>;
+				reg = <0x41a2 0x2>;
+				bits = <5 8>;
 			};
 		};
